Output d59328b13ff33a54dcfc4000cecdc426757c3c2521aaa9b337760f993284e3c9:4

value
437497
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d74b891867fd3eef795812fd2c82602f0cdb5f0 OP_EQUALVERIFY OP_CHECKSIG
address
1MBxAJxwVQQHBaiepdnCExLTpH2AD59UJe
transaction
d59328b13ff33a54dcfc4000cecdc426757c3c2521aaa9b337760f993284e3c9